Transaction 77d5fe7a39e403aab7723bb24c4f030faf5dee1215d0a63bc58510b990965216
2 Input
2 Outputs
- 77d5fe7a39e403aab7723bb24c4f030faf5dee1215d0a63bc58510b990965216:0
- 77d5fe7a39e403aab7723bb24c4f030faf5dee1215d0a63bc58510b990965216:1
value 200000
address 32HNFMN1DGXpqtsy2zaTVTWfuGPxAirLeK
value 1172876
address 1LgbKJu8JuL6fobh4NMVmgm7tZT7hS2xVQ